**Key Responsibilities
Operational Management
- Oversee the day-to-day operations of the nursing home, ensuring smooth and efficient functioning.
-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ations, standards, and guidelines.
- Develop and implement policies and procedures to maintain high standards of care and service.
Resident Care
- Ensure that all residents receive high-quality, person-centered care that meets their individual needs.
- Monitor and evaluate the quality of care provided, implementing improvements as necessary.
- Address any concerns or complaints from residents and their families promptly and effectively.
Staff Management
- Lead, manage, and motivate a diverse team of healthcare professionals, including nurses, caregivers, and support staff.
- Conduct regular performance reviews and provide ongoing training and professional development opportunities.
- Manage staffing levels to ensure adequate coverage and optimal care delivery.
Financial Management
- Develop and manage the nursing home's budget, ensuring financial sustainability.
- Oversee the management of resources, including supplies and equipment.
- Monitor and control expenditures, ensuring cost-effective operations.
Compliance and Safety
- Ensure the nursing home meets all legal and regulatory requirements, including health and safety standards.
- Conduct regular audits and inspections to maintain compliance and quality assurance.
- Develop and implement emergency procedures and safety protocols.
Community Relations
- Foster positive relationships with residents, families, and the local community.
- Act as a liaison with healthcare providers, regulatory bodies, and other stakeholders.
- Promote the nursing home within the community to enhance its reputation and attract new residents.
